Try Blackstone. I've been using them for about a year now and along with the report they includes a few paragraphs that discuss the results and point out any possibly looming issues.
They charge $20 per (you can pay less if you buy in bulk). You can request a free kit from them, and send a check for $20 with it and you get a hardcopy and electronic versions.
VERY good information to have. I use it to keep an eye on everything that takes oil (specially my track bike - blowing an engine at 160 MPH would... er... . blow).
